Detalles del Curso
- Introduction to Traffic Control Devices – Overview of traffic control devices, their importance, and various types.
- Traffic Signs – Detailed study of different traffic signs, their meanings, and usage.
- Pavement Markings – Explanation of pavement markings, their significance, and application in traffic control.
- Traffic Signals – Understanding of traffic signal operation, types, and maintenance.
- Work Zone Traffic Control – Study of traffic control in work zones, temporary traffic control devices, and their implementation.
-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S) – Introduction to ITS, its components, and their impact on traffic control.
- Regulations and Standards – Overview of traffic control device regulations, standards, and agencies at national and local levels.
- Safety and Best Practices – Safety considerations, best practices, and guidelines for installing and maintaining traffic control devices.
- Planning and Designing Traffic Control Devices – Techniques for planning, designing, and evaluating traffic control devices.
Trayectoria Profesional
In the UK, the demand for traffic control device professionals is on the rise.
This 3D pie chart highlights the four primary roles in this sector, showcasing their respective job market presence. - Transportation Engineers : Accounting for 40% of the job market, these professionals design, construct, and maintain transportation infrastructure, including roads, bridges, and traffic control devices. - Traffic Technicians : Representing 30% of the sector, traffic technicians install, maintain, and repair traffic signals, signs, and pavement markings. - Transportation Planners : With 20% of the jobs, transportation planners develop and implement transportation policies and strategies, optimizing traffic flow and safety. - Traffic Management Specialists : Making up the remaining 10%, these professionals monitor and control traffic systems, deploying resources during incidents and special events.
